Introduction
Selenium toxicity has been of concern to states in the Western
United States since the 1930s. Selenium deficiency has been of nationwide concern for a
number of years also. In Wyoming, both toxic and deficient conditions have been
identified. In 1987, a Governor's Task Force was created to investigate the status of
selenium in Wyoming. In 1988, funding was made available from the Wyoming Water Resources
Center to acquire key literature on selenium for the use of the Task Force. In order to
facilitate the use of the literature and assist selenium research in Wyoming, this
bibliography and index have been generated.
Subtopics within the index are cross referenced within main topic
categories. For example, listings for specific plant species are also listed under
"Plants". "Plants" listings are included in the main topic "Soil
and Plant Science". This bibliography does not include all bibliographic references
for selenium. Selected references that apply to ongoing or needed research in Wyoming were
given preference.
